Handover Note — From Director Anya Kellridge to Director Soren Malt

For the board's reference: the Osprey Lane launch plan is fully drafted. Manufacturing at the Derrow facility is on schedule, channel agreements are signed, and the marketing sequence begins six weeks pre-launch. Risk register and contingency budget are attached to the plan itself. Outstanding item: final pricing sign-off. The confidential strategic note is appended below.

internal memo for kawip-hadug: Headcount on the Wenwyn team goes from 7 to 140 by the end of January. Gross margin on Wenwyn came in at 20 percent against a plan of 15 percent.

FACILITIES TICKET — Ref: cage visit, Hallowmere Data Centre

Requested by: Ops, Perrin Analytics. Visit window: Thursday, 09:00–12:00. Purpose: swap two failed drives in Cage 14, Hall B. Escort not required — technician is pre-cleared. Assistants: book parking via the Hallowmere portal, print the work order, and remind the tech to bring anti-static kit. No tools left in the cage overnight. Access via east loading entrance only; main lobby is closed for works. The badge code for Cage 14 is as follows.

turnstile pass: bdg-QZV-3

Runbook: Brightmoor API behind the Stilefront load balancer. Health checks hit the shallow endpoint every few seconds; deep checks run less often and verify the database pool. Three consecutive failures pull a node from rotation; two passes restore it. Support: if all nodes drop at once, suspect the deep check dependency, not the app. Do not restart nodes before checking the balancer panel. Verify timeouts match what's deployed. Current health-check configuration for the production pool follows below.

config for kawif-hahig:
zorix:
  log_level: error
  metrics_host: metrics.zorix.lumiclabs.internal
  pool_size: 16

## Releases

Starting with Pylon 4.2, all telemetry payloads shipped in release bundles are compressed with the Varrow codec before packaging. The release manager must verify that the compressed archive matches the manifest digest recorded in `telemetry/manifest.lock`, since downstream ingest nodes at Halverd reject mismatched bundles silently. Run `pylon pack --verify` twice: once pre-signing, once post. Every release archive must be signed with the current deploy key, shown below.

deploy key for yajop-fahop: bky3_h1v